Atlanta Dream star Brittney Griner received a threatening message that was so disturbing that she removed herself from a public event out of fear for her safety.

According to TMZ Sports, Brittney Griner was scheduled to speak at the Women Grow Leadership Summit in National Harbor, Maryland. The WNBA legend bowed out for her safety after coming across a disturbing hotel room that read, “Gay Baby Jail.”

More from the report:

“We’re told Griner — who is gay and was, of course, once imprisoned in Russia for marijuana possession — was mortified at the message … and immediately canceled her scheduled appearance to return home.

TMZ Sports has learned … the WNBA superstar was slated to talk at the Women Grow Leadership Summit in National Harbor, Md. — but bolted from the event on Monday morning after discovering a piece of duct tape near her entryway that had the words “Gay Baby Jail” written on it.”

However, police officials believe the note was merely a “coincidence” and not an intended threat against Griner. The Prince George’s County Police Department put out the following statement, per TMZ Sports:

“Detectives have learned the phrase ‘gay baby jail’ is commonly used as a video game reference. At the time the tape was located, a large convention was taking place at the Gaylord which attracts thousands of people, many with an interest in anime as well as video game enthusiasts. At this time, detectives have uncovered no link to or threat against the guest who located the tape.”

Brittney Griner has been married to her wife, Chanelle, since 2019. The two had their first child, a boy, last July. Griner has been a major advocate for LGBTQ rights, donating $5,000 to a Phoenix youth center in 2017.

Monday marked three years since the 34-year-old Griner was arrested in Russia for containing under a gram of hash oil. She was sentenced to nine years in prison six months later, but four months later, President Joe Biden agreed to a 1-for-1 prisoner swap with Russian officials that sent convicted arms dealer Viktor Bout back to Russia.

The 10-time WNBA All-Star spent her entire career with the Phoenix Mercury from 2013-2024 before testing free agency this year. The 2014 WNBA Champion left the Mercury to sign a one-year pact with the Atlanta Dream in free agency.

The Dream are coming off a disappointing 15-25 season that saw them get swept in the opening round of the playoffs by the New York Liberty. The Dream haven’t won a playoff series since 2016, but we’ll see if the addition of Griner can end the drought in 2025.
